Can a solar inverter work with a DC power supply?

The inverter can work with the standard DC power supply used as the power source, instead of the solar panel. The power supply has to meet the specification of the 30 V DC output voltage and a 4 A max output current. When the DC power supply is used, the MPPT feature does not function.

How to choose a solar panel connector?

It is advisable to choose a connector with a higher current rating than that of your solar panels in order to avoid any potential issues with electrical conductivity. Maximum voltage: It's crucial to examine the maximum voltage that the connectors for solar panels can bear without suffering damage or malfunction.

Can a single DSC control a whole inverter?

This topology shows the ability to control the whole inverter with a single DSC. The overall load of the DSC is about 50 % without the battery charger option implemented. The battery charger option takes on an added DSC load of about 10 to 12 %. It is possible to use two DSCs–one on the primary side and one on the secondary side.
